WESFARMERS Chemicals, Energy, and Fertilisers division (WesCEF) announced yesterday that its Managing Director, Ian Hansen, will retire in Nov.
Hansen, who has played a pivotal role in the growth and success of the company, will continue to serve in an advisory role, particularly in the Group's burgeoning lithium business, remaining as Chairman of Covalent Lithium.
Aaron Hood, currently the Chief Operating Officer at WesCEF, will be Hansen's successor.
Hood, who has held various senior executive positions including Chief Financial Officer and Executive General Manager of Business Development, was promoted to Deputy Managing Director effective yesterday.
He will retain his COO duties until he officially takes over as Managing Director in Nov.
